Subject: REFS: NASA AMES VIEW Project (1989!)

This is their Virtual ENvironment Workstation, presented as part of a
SIGGRAPH '89 course by Scott Fisher.

Below are some citations "lifted" from my VITB (Virtual Interface
Technology Bibligraphy):

Fisher, S. S., McGreevy, M., Humphries, J. and Robinett, W.  (1986).
Virtual Environment Display System.  In Proceedings of ACM Workshop on
Interactive 3-D Graphics.  New York, NY: ACM.

Fisher, S. S., McGreevy, M., Humphries, J. and Robinett, W.  (1986).
Virtual Workstation: A Multimodal, Stereoscopic Display Environment.
In Proceedings of the SPIE - The International Society for Optical
Engineering, Vol.  726.  Intelligent Robots and Computer Vision.
(pp. 517-522).  Bellingham, WA: SPIE.

Fisher, S. S., McGreevy, M., Humphries, J. and Robinett, W.  (1987).
Virtual Interface Environment for Telepresence Applications.  In
J. D. Berger (Ed.)  Proceedings of International Topical Meeting on
Remote Systems and Robotics in Hostile Environments.  (pp. x-y).  La
Grange Park, ILL: American Nuclear Society.

Fisher, S., Jacoby, R., Byrson, S., Stone, P., McDowall, I., Bolas,
M., Dasaro, D., Wenzel, E. and Coler, C. D.  (1991).  The Ames Virtual
Environment Workstation: Implementation Issues and Requirements.
Human-Machine Interfaces for Teleoperators and Virtual Environments
(Available through NTIS, ADA2407161XSP).  (pp. 20-24).  Washington,
DC: NASA.
